Russian Railways Suspends Train Services From Moscow to Sofia, Budapest

Russia's Federal Passenger Company suspends regular trains from Moscow to Bulgaria's Sofia and Budapest (Hungary) until further notice as of December 12 and in the opposite direction – as of December 14.

This was announced in an official statement published on the company's website. FPC noted that the decision was made "in connection with a significant decrease in passenger traffic" on these routes.

Federal Passenger Company was founded in 2009 as a 100% subsidiary of Russian Railways.
